Post
Topic
Board Altcoin Discussion
Re: Anonymity
by
fluffypony
on 07/08/2014, 12:00:54 UTC
ring signatures used in coins like monero cause blockchain bloat making them unusable for mainstream adoption...so no...XC is what your looking for, read it and weep if your not invested already https://bitcointalk.org/index.php?topic=630547.0  Roll Eyes

Can you explain a little about mainstream adoption and its compatibility problem with the ring signatures?

It's a very tired argument that gets pulled out and rebutted each time. The Monero blockchain is currently 5.5x the size of the Bitcoin one for comparable total transactions (so linearly larger than Bitcoin's). So when we've had 44 million transactions (as Bitcoin has over its 5.5 year existence) our blockchain will be about 110gb vs. Bitcoin's current 20gb blockchain. This is, in itself, not a problem, as by the time we get there in a few  years disk space will be appreciably larger, and we'll have the same full node problem Bitcoin has (who seriously keeps the full 20gb Bitcoin blockchain on their laptop, for instance) - the majority of our userbase will use lightweight wallets.

A lot of the people that state that Monero has a "blockchain bloat" problem are picking up snippets of conversation between quite intelligent people on the matter without actually understanding the issue. Monero has exactly the same "bloat" problem as XC, DarkCoin, and anything else that uses a form of mixing - you are going to incur additional entries in the blockchain for every mix (or in Monero's case for every additional signature in a ring), which means the blockchain for all of them is going to be linearly larger than Bitcoin's for the same number of transactions. It is a compromise you accept if you want transaction privacy: it uses more space in the blockchain. However, the advantage that a Bitcoin-derived altcoin has is that it can prune the bloated blockchain, whereas with Monero you can never tell if a utxo has actually been spent or just used in a ring signature, so pruning in the Bitcoin sense is not possible. THIS is what they're actually claiming - that all of the blockchains are going to bloat, but Monero's can't be pruned the way Bitcoin's can. It's very, very important to note alongside this that the Bitcoin blockchain has never been pruned, the code to operate off a pruned blockchain is simply not there (that notwithstanding, as of Bitcoin Core 0.9.0 it does have the ability to prune provably unspendable outputs, but that is not the same as the blockchain pruning we are referring to). Therefore, none of these Bitcoin-derived altcoins are actually able to prune their blockchain, despite their belief that they can flick a switch and voila, magically small blockchain. Not unless they have the ability to write code that the Bitcoin core developers and hundreds of contributors have yet to write.